The History of the 98104 Zip Code Map

The 98104 Zip Code Map has a rich history dating back to Seattle's early days as a pioneer settlement. The neighborhood of Pioneer Square was one of the city's first commercial districts, and many of its historic buildings have been preserved and repurposed for modern use. Visitors can take a walking tour of the area to learn more about its colorful past, or visit the Klondike Gold Rush National Historical Park to explore exhibits about the Yukon gold rush of 1897.

Q: What is the Seattle Underground Tour, and is it worth doing?

A: The Seattle Underground Tour is a guided tour of the city's historic underground tunnels, which were created after the Great Fire of 1889. The tour is a popular attraction for visitors to the 98104 Zip Code Map, and offers a unique perspective on Seattle's early days. However, some visitors find the tour to be too touristy and not very informative.
